PYROTECHNIC
CHEMISTRY |
 |
All pyrotechnic chemical compositions contain an oxidizer component and
a fuel component. Additional ingredients that are present in most pyrotechnic
compositions include binding agents, retardants and waterproofing agents.
Smoke dyes and color intensifiers are present as required.

Oxidizers
are usually substances that release oxygen at high temperatures. Oxygen
is provided by the nitrates of barium, strontium, sodium and potassium;
by the Perchlorate of ammonium and potassium; and by the peroxides of
barium, strontium and lead.
- The pyrotechnic fuel components include finely powered metals such
as aluminum, magnesium, metal hydrates, red phosphorous, sulfur and
other materials.
- Binding agents in a pyrotechnic composition include resin, waxes,
plastics and oils.
- Color intensifiers are highly chlorinated organic compounds such as
hexachlorophene (C2Cl6), hexachlorobenzene (C6Cl6) and polyvinyl chloride.
- Smoke dyes are azo and anthraquinone dyes. These dyes provide the
color in smokes used for signaling, marking and spotting.
Pyrotechnic compositions are used to produce pyrotechnic devices such
as:
- Illuminating Flares
Usually made from 55% magnesium, 38% sodium nitrate and 6% binder. IPI

- Infrared Flares
These flares use metals rather than sodium.

- Tracer Composition
The tracer composition is used mainly in small arms ammunition for spotting,
incendiary and fire control purposes. The light produced by the burning
tracer composition is used for tracking.

- Delay Elements
A delay element uses a contained pyrotechnic delay composition in an
ignition train to provide a delayed ignition. Examples of uses for the
delay compositions specified below are fuze explosive trains and cartridge
actuated devices.
| Delay
Composition |
Spec. |
Formulation |
| Zirconium Nickel Alloy Delay Composition |
MIL-C-13739A |
Zirconium Nickel Alloy, Powdered,
MIL-Z-11410
Barium Chromate, MIL-B-550
Potassium Perchlorate, MIL-P-217 |
| Manganese Delay Composition |
MIL-M-21383A |
Manganese Powder, JAN-M-476
Barium Chromate, MIL-B-550
Lead Chromate, JAN-L-488 |
| Tungsten Delay Composition |
MIL-T-23132A |
Tungsten Powder, AS-2686
Barium Chromate, MIL-B-550
Potassium Perchlorate, MIL-P-217 |

- Ignition Elements
An ignition element uses a contained pyrotechnic ignition
composition to provide a specific ignition pulse.
- Fireworks
Fireworks use different pyrotechnic compositions to provide a color,
illumination and sound effects.
- Signal Flares
These flares are small and fast burning. Various metals
are added to the composition to control the color of the flare.
